Description

"Captured Gear: Hospitalman James E. Stanley, a corpsman attached to the 1st Platoon of M Company, 3d Battalion, 1st Marines [M/3/1] examines a North Vietnamese helmet and entrenching tool that the platoon found after overrunning an enemy bunker position on Hill 512, southeast of Khe Sanh (official USMC photo by Lance Corporal J. V. Kinnaird)."

From the Jonathan F. Abel Collection (COLL/3611) at the Archives Branch, Marine Corps History Division
